Scandinavian apartment with vintage touches (59 sqm)

This Scandinavian apartment (59 sq.m.) looks very much similar to typical living spaces in our post-Soviet countries. A small kitchen is combined with a living room, an average bedroom and a tiny bathroom, a hall and a balcony. Everything is done very simply and at the same time interesting. Finishing as minimal as possible: just white walls, floor and ceiling. But the filling turned out to be delicious – here it is vintage: numerous gilded candlesticks, seen kinds of shabby table and carpet, the sweetest drawings and posters. A special highlight of the design is the details, without them it would be boring and uncomfortable here. Details with history and certain chaos in the arrangement of objects will make your interior alive, and what is most important: soulful and cozy.
